Originally posted by dragonglen
Is it just me, or are the rotors on the wrong side? I thought the gasses were supposed to escape out of the slots. I thought that was true too, but I found this post on another car forum.
Slot direction is inconsequential. They are only there to "clean" the pads as they wear to prevent glazing. In or out doesn't matter. What matters with brake rotor orientation is the VANE direction. The cooling vanes built into the rotor should always open away from the direction of rotation. The latest trend is for the cleaning slots to go "backward" because this makes for a stronger rotor. Instead of being inline with (and possibly inbetween) the cooling vanes, by running against them the slots are now supported by a number of ribs/vanes.
And this Baer brake rotor specifies the "wrong" direction as proper.
